Asian stocks rise as tech giants rally, SoftBank jumps 11.6%

South Korea's Kospi is up 3.6 percent at lunchtime, following gains by several of the stock market's heavyweights. For example, Samsung Electronics is up 4.1 percent and Seoul Semiconductor is up 6.0 percent.

On Friday, South Korean SK Hynix will also be listed on the American Nasdaq. The company is a supplier to chip giant Nvidia, among other things, and rose 1.5 percent in South Korea during morning trading.

In Tokyo, technology-focused investment company SoftBank climbed by a whopping 11.6 percent. Overall, the Nikkei 225 increased by 1.7 percent and the Topix by 0.7 percent.

In China, Shenzhen is up 0.6 percent and Shanghai is up 0.5 percent. Hong Kong's Hang Seng is up 1.5 percent.
